### Step 4 — Sign the ledger release

Before tagging the Pindrel loyalty-points ledger build, verify the double-entry invariants pass in the Saffold staging run and that the reconciliation report shows zero drift. Once you have confirmed both, sign the release artifact with the deploy key below.

deploy key for kajof-yawif: bky9_fvxrpdHPq

Subject: Reminder job release — clinic notifications

Hi, this is the release note for the Meadowcare appointment reminder job, version 1.8. Changes: reminders now respect per-clinic quiet hours, and duplicate sends for rescheduled appointments are suppressed. The job ran clean in staging across three simulated clinics overnight with zero duplicates. No schema changes, no rollback concerns. Please schedule the production rollout for Thursday. The candidate build token is below.

pipeline stamp: htk9_6ce9d33c5

## Calendar Sync Conflict (duplicate events)

If Meadowplan shows duplicate events after a sync, the Brightvale connector likely retried a stale batch. Clear the delta cursor in the sync table and re-run the reconciler. To call the reconciler endpoint manually, authenticate with the bearer token below.

login token, bagug-kafop: eyJhbGciOiJIUzI1NiIsInR5cCI6IkpXVCJ9.eyJzdWIiOiIcMLov2In0.Z5RLDIfp

**Action item: AP-412 — autocomplete index latency**

Owner: Marisol (platform). The Quillfeather suggest index degraded after the prefix table doubled. Fix: shard the trie by first two characters and cap fanout per query. If you're new to the Brindlehop stack, read the indexer doc first; don't touch the merge scheduler. Deploy behind the flag. The constants below were validated in staging and must not be changed without a load test.

tuning constants:
QUOTAS = {
    "druwyn": 5,
    "holix": 5,
    "zorath": 5,
    "holwyn": 10,
}